You’ve got to give it to Congress’ media strategists for being, well, the worst media strategists ever. We suggest they learn a little from the All India Anna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am (AIADMK), both the OPS and Sasikala fraction, on how to manage and command media attention. To start with, they could just begin by watching some television news to realise that nothing, we repeat nothing, can get news anchors’ attention away from the drama that’s unfolding in Chennai by the minute. Heck, if it can eclipse the Uttar Pradesh election, what are Ajay Maken and his little press conferences in Delhi?
Here’s what the president of Delhi state Congress tweeted out in the afternoon.
The big announcement was apparently that sitting Aam Aadmi Party Councillor from Nanakpura, New Delhi, Anil Malik has joined Congress. Maken also stated that others from AAP and Bharatiya Janata Party wanted to join Congress.
The Hindu seems to have been the only paper present at the press conference.
At the time of this short going up, not a single channel had cut to the conference or even flashed the development on its ticker. Neither have any of the news organisations Twitter handle woken up to this. Incidentally, even Malik’s Twitter handle hasn’t.

Congress could not have chosen a worse day or time than this because the conference on any other day would have at least generated a ticker update, if not a prime-time debate.
